Joe Biden is the 46th President of the United States, having taken office on January 20, 2021. A member of the Democratic Party, he previously served as Vice President under Barack Obama from 2009 to 2017. Biden has focused on various key issues during his presidency, including economic recovery, healthcare, and climate change. His administration has emphasized 'Bidenomics,' which aims to address inflation and promote economic growth.
